How to Learn a New Programming Language as a Tech Professional

As a tech professional, it is important to upskill and stay relevant to the growing demands of the ever-evolving tech industry.

Learning a new programming language is one way to stay current and can also open doors to innovative projects, enhanced problem-solving abilities, and better career prospects.

However, the process of learning a new programming language can be daunting, especially for seasoned professionals who already have a deep understanding of other languages.

The challenge lies not only in grasping new syntax and semantics but also in integrating new paradigms and best practices into their existing knowledge base.

This guide outlines a strategic approach to effectively learning a new programming language, ensuring you leverage your existing knowledge while acquiring new skills.

| 1 | Understanding Your Motivation and Setting Goals

Before diving into a new programming language, it's crucial to understand why you want to learn it. Are you looking to advance your career, start a new project, or solve specific problems?

Set clear goals and define what you want to achieve, such as building a particular type of application, contributing to open-source projects, or simply expanding your knowledge base as this will guide your learning process and keep you motivated.